A BLACKMOOR schoolgirl said farewell to her locks last Saturday - all for a good cause.

Seven-year-old Molly Flavell visited Natty B’s Hair Studio, in Chalet Hill, Bordon, where 16 inches was snipped away from her hair, which will be donated to the Little Princess Trust charity, which makes wigs for children having cancer treatment.

Molly, a pupil at St Matthew’s Primary School in Blackmoor, had been growing her hair ahead of the cut.

Grandmother Margaret Standen said: “It would have been an awful waste to have just discarded such a lovely length of human hair when this wonderful charity exists.”
